Matū retail venture fund to list on Catalist

Nascent equity exchange Catalist has secured Matū Iramoe, an early-stage venture fund aimed at retail investors, as its first listing.The firm is a subsidiary of science and deep-tech investor Matū Group, which helps start-ups commercialise scientific research.The subsidiary will give retail investors a way to invest money in Matū’s pre-seed and seed fund Karahi, and is seeking to raise up to $1 million in the first initial public offer held on Catalist’s public market.Catalist is a new exchange designed for small and medium-sized b...
